Dr Liyuan Wei is an Associate Professor in Marketing at Southampton Business School, University of Southampton. She joined the university in 2024 after academic positions at Brunel University London and City University of Hong Kong. Her research explores intersections between digital strategies, consumer psychology, technology, wellbeing, and quantitative methods.
- PhD: Rotman School of Management, University of Toronto
Her research focuses on responsible consumption, ethical marketing practices, and consumer wellbeing. She employs quantitative methodologies to examine digital marketing impacts and develops frameworks for healthy aging interventions through marketing strategies.
Recent publications demonstrate expertise in tourism marketing, film industry analytics, healthcare interventions, and sustainability research. Key themes include mindfulness in ethical consumption, pandemic response strategies, and digital loyalty systems. Articles appear in journals like Journal of Policy Research in Tourism, International Journal of Research in Marketing, and Journal of Business Research.
Teaching responsibilities include Marketing Research Methods, Marketing Analytics, Digital Marketing, and Strategic Marketing. She actively supervises PhD students in marketing-related topics and welcomes new applicants.
